1. A Dazzling Display of Lights
Start your holiday adventure at Butch Bando’s Fantasy of Lights, a mesmerizing drive-through light show that runs until January 1. Snuggle up in your car and tune in to holiday tunes as you navigate through a dazzling array of lights that spark joy and ignite the festive spirit. Don’t forget to check out local favorites like the Wanderlights at Columbus Commons, where brilliantly lit displays create a magical atmosphere from 5 to 10 PM each night until February 15.
2. Celebrate Traditions with The Nutcracker
Gather the family and immerse yourselves in the enchanting world of ballet by attending The Nutcracker at the historic Ohio Theatre, presented by BalletMet from December 11 to 28. This classic performance features breathtaking choreography and whimsical sets that transport audiences into a fairytale realm—the perfect way to celebrate the holiday season with your loved ones.
3. Explore Holiday Markets and Local Goods
Don’t miss out on quality time spent shopping at local holiday markets! Attend the Columbus Winterfair at the Ohio Expo Center from December 5 to 7, where you can discover handmade artisan crafts while supporting local creators. Plus, enjoy festive treats and live music to get everyone into the spirit of the season.
4. Festive Family Fun at Wander Nights
On select Fridays and Saturdays (December 5, 6, 12, 13, 19, and 20), Wander Nights at Columbus Commons offers a delightful evening of free fun with activities like hot chocolate, trolley rides, and cozy fire pits. This community gathering is a fantastic opportunity for families to bond while enjoying seasonal snacks and entertainment under the twinkling lights.
5. Outdoor Euphoria at Easton
Head over to Easton Town Center for a stunning holiday spectacle! The Grand Illumination event, which kicked off on November 14, features over two million lights illuminating the town, alongside fun family festivities—live music, costumed characters, and delightful seasonal shopping!
6. Savor the Spirit of Giving
Engage in the spirit of the holidays by visiting the Huntington Holiday Train Display at the Main Library in Downtown Columbus. This beloved tradition showcases intricate train displays and festive decorations that captivate the imagination of children and adults alike. It runs until early January, making it a great stop during your holiday outings.
7. Unique Experiences to Share
For something different, consider going to the Menorah Lighting at Easton on December 15. This event honors Hanukkah and provides an opportunity to celebrate diversity in the community. Try to attend the 12 Elves of Dublin Scavenger Hunt for a fun way to explore downtown while looking for hidden elves and earning prizes!
